Even more complicated redirect scheme
This: ?_filter_column_1=name&_filter_op_1=contains&_filter_value_1=hello &_filter_column_2=age&_filter_op_2=gte&_filter_value_2=12 Now redirects to this: ?name__contains=hello&age__gte=12 This is needed for the filter editing interface, refs #86sanic-07
